The yarnistas have selected a fun lace top for Must Make Monday this week – MyTeeser. It is designed in Knitting for Olive Pure Silk, which arrived to the shop this month and has been teasing us all with its gorgeous colors and shine.

MyTeeser is knit in the round from the top down with no seaming. The lace yoke is charted. It’s a lightweight piece that you can layer over a linen dress, pair with denim shorts or a skirt.

Sizing:

A (B) C (D) E (F) G (H) I

Bust circumference: 33 (35,5) 39,25 (43,25) 47,25 (51) 55 (59) 63”

Designer recommends zero ease for this garment.

Full length: 19,75” 50cm, or shorter/longer if preferred.

Materials:

  • 766 (820) 875 (930) 1039 (1149) 1258 (1367) 1477 yards of fingering weight yarn OR 3 (3) 4 (4) 4 (5) 5  (5) 6 balls of Knitting for Olive Pure Silk
  • Ribbing needle; US#2.5 (3 mm) circular
  • Main needles; US#2.5 (3 mm) for lace section
  • US#4 (3,5 mm) for stockinette section
  • Copy of pattern by Jill Karina Bø

Gauge: 24 stitches over 4” 10 cm – Finished garment, washed and blocked.
